A Plane polarized light is incident on a piece of quartz cut parallel to its axis. Evaluate the least thickness for which ordinary ray and extraordinary ray combine to form the plane polarized light. Given µ0 = 1.5442, µE = 1.5533, λ = 5×10-5 cm.
